Extend contract with Fraser & Associates for bond disclosure work through 2023
$48,000
In Plain English
The Successor Agency hired Fraser & Associates in 2018 to handle required financial reporting for city bonds. The original $8,000 contract proved insufficient for the ongoing paperwork requirements. If approved, the contract increases to $48,000 total and runs through 2023 with possible extensions to ensure compliance with bond regulations.
